immunoelectrophoresis
(redirected from rocket immunoelectrophoresis)

   Also found in: Medical, Encyclopedia, Wikipedia 0.01 sec.
im·mu·no·e·lec·tro·pho·re·sis  (my-n--lktr-f-rss, -my-)
n.
The separation and identification of proteins based on differences in electrical charge and reactivity with antibodies.

immunoelectrophoresis [ˌɪmjʊnəʊɪˌlɛktrəʊfəˈriːsɪs]
n
(Medicine) a technique for identifying the antigens in a blood serum, which are separated into fractions by electrophoresis

7) Fibrinogen can be quantitated by various methods including precipitation or denaturation methods, turbidimetric or fibrin clot density method, coagulable protein assays, as well as immunologic assays, which utilize antibodies to fibrinogen in assays, such as radial immunodiffusion, measurement of turbidity or rocket immunoelectrophoresis and the modified thrombin clotting time, which is the most widely performed clinical fibrinogen assay.
